Output 1183d512efe3b58a28d9e8614d7ed6c95baf1e5960cbd3b366be221a5b766595:1

value
1073083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d37c441d13187bae85ff44a7fcf7637e2773f5 OP_EQUAL
address
MDMVT1ftoAopvXGfdVpvBVtp859DFThiqE
transaction
1183d512efe3b58a28d9e8614d7ed6c95baf1e5960cbd3b366be221a5b766595
spent
true